India must win one match against Australia to retain 2nd spot

India must win one match against Australia to retain 2nd spot

Rediff.com10 Jan 2016

India will need to win at least a game in the upcoming one-dayer series against Australia to retain their current second position in the ICC ODI Team Championships, even as second-placed Virat Kohli looks to close in on AB de Villiers in the batting chart. World champions Australia go head to head with former winner India in a five-match series in Perth on Tuesday. Australia (127) lead second-ranked India (114) by 13 points and even if they lose all the five matches of the series, they will drop points but still finish a point ahead of India.

Australia is World No 1 Test team; India slip to 3rd

Australia is World No 1 Test team; India slip to 3rd

Rediff.com1 May 2020

Australia have moved to the top of the Test and T20I rankings for men while England continue to lead the men's ODI rankings after the annual update carried out on Friday, which eliminates results from 2016-17. In the latest update, that rates all matches played since May 2019 at 100 per cent and those of the previous two years at 50 per cent, Australia (116) have taken over from India as the top ranked side in the MRF Tyres ICC Men's Test Team Rankings with New Zealand (115) remaining in second place. India are now third with 114 points.
